"The Horsehead and Flame Nebulae".
The Horsehead Nebula (also known as Barnard 33 in emission nebula IC 434) is a dark nebula in the constellation Orion. The nebula is located just to the south of the star Alnitak, which is farthest east on Orion's Belt.The Flame Nebula, designated as NGC 2024, is an emission nebula.It is about 900 to 1,500 light-years away.
